All Stars Recap June 15, 2024

The annual Marin Swim League All-Star took place at Archie Williams High School on the first Saturday of summer (for most kids). The sun was shining as families from across Marin arrived, ready to watch the fastest swimmers in the county compete. Sleepy Hollow was a ready host, greeting guests with smiles and event bags at the volunteer check-in desk, hosting a bustling snack bar, an efficient tech desk, and providing competent and experienced Officials to run a smooth and speedy meet. Each and every event was a nail biter, with first through eighth place finishers in literal seconds of each other in each event. The Sea Lions saw incredible performances, including Anna Lucchese, who swam very fast in her Girls 8&U 25Y Free and 100Y I.M., snagging some personal best times. Hailey Bennett swam personal best times in all three of her races – Girls 50Y Free, 50Y Back, and 100Y I.M. Zoe Singleton also picked up the pace and swam personal best times in all three races, the Girls 11-12 50Y Free, 50Y Fly, and 100Y I.M. Hunter Panzica and Elsa Kastner saw some unbelievable drops to improve upon their best times, and secured wins in all three of their races to earn them Triple Crown status! There were 65 best times from our All Star Sea Lions on Saturday, as our top swimmers were pushed by the very best in the league. Congratulations to all of our All Star swimmers! Friday, June 28: Shave Down

All 11 & Ups are invited to come to a Shave Down & Pasta Potluck Dinner to get ready for Champs. Shaving is a ritual swimmers perform before a big meet to reduce frictional drag and get into a fast mindset! And don’t worry, if you don’t want to shave, you don’t have to! Come have fun with your teammates and carbo-load before Champs!

If you do want to shave, please bring your own razor and shaving cream. We'll have buckets of water and band-aids on hand in the unlikely event of a nick.

MSL CHAMPIONSHIP MEET - Saturday, June 29th

The Championship Meet, aka "Champs" is the final meet of the season, where every MSL team participates. Every swimmer swims! No qualifications are necessary.  The Sleepy Hollow Swim Team has won Champs for 28 years in a row and we have every intention of keeping this incredible streak going! WHEN & WHERE

Scott Valley Sea Serpents are excited to host Championships this year on Saturday, June 29, 2024, at Miwok Aquatic Center, IVC College of Marin. Warm ups will start at 7 am, and the meet starts at 8:30am.

 

LOGISTICS 

This is a brief outline of this year's meet! HERE is the Meet Packet, which everyone MUST read.  It has details about everything (timing, meet format, parking, spectators, awards ceremony) and will answer your questions.

Champs will run like last year-  two meets will be happening simultaneously- on opposite ends of the pool- a girl’s side (closer to the warm up pool), and boy's side (closer to the dive tank). 10 lanes per side! All 60 events will run in order.

All relays will be swum on the dive tank side of the pool. 

Please plan on the first half of the meet running roughly 8:30 am -11:30 am with the second half running 11:45 am - 2:30 pm. There will be a 15 minute break after backstroke for volunteer changes. There will be an awards ceremony at the conclusion of the meet.

The Miwok pool has extremely limited deck space, therefore this will be a closed deck meet. No spectators will be allowed on the pool deck. Only swimmers, coaches, and volunteers! There are bleachers, but they are not huge. The best way to watch your swimmer swim is to volunteer!

Also note, to allow for viewing from the bleachers, there will not be tents over the blocks. Please keep this in mind if you are a timer. Wear a hat!

Our team will set up in the grassy field outside the pool gates. Like always, it is important to pay attention to the event numbers on the board so your swimmer does not miss a race. If you have never attended Champs, it’s helpful to know that it will be crowded -- 1000 swimmers, 400 volunteers and lots of spectators.
